## Deploy Step 4: Graphlume Visualizer

Before promoting Graphlume to staging, confirm the renderer can reach the graph ingestion service. Set GRAPH_INGEST_URL to the staging endpoint and GRAPH_MAX_NODES to 50000 — higher values have caused renderer OOMs twice this quarter. Verify the layout worker count matches the node pool size. The ingestion service requires an authenticated connection, and its credential is declared on the next line of the env file.

sealed setting: LEDGER_TOKEN13=5d842615a26d7

## Changelog — Font vendoring defaults changed

As of this release, the Bracken UI build no longer fetches third-party fonts at build time. All typefaces used by the Lanternwell suite are now vendored into the repo under a dedicated assets directory, and the fetch step is skipped by default. If you're onboarding, nothing to install — the fonts travel with the checkout. The build flags controlling this behavior are listed below.

settings of hadup-yafog:
LAMAEL_PIN=3761
LAMAEL_TENANT=istmir
LAMAEL_METRICS_HOST=metrics.lamael.plorvasys.test
LAMAEL_SEAL=seal_8ea68500
LAMAEL_STANDBY_TEAM=fraok

Subject: Key rotation — Murmurline sampling service

Plugin authors,

The Murmurline log-sampling key rotates tonight at 02:00. Old keys stop working immediately after cutover. If your plugin emits to the chatty Fenwick ingest path, note that sampling drops to 1-in-50 above 10k lines/min; don't rely on full capture. Update your config, redeploy, and confirm sampled output in the Murmurline dashboard before morning. No grace period this cycle.

The replacement key for the internal sampler endpoint follows below.

gateway credential: kto23_LX9A4ys6i4nzHtpOLNLodKK

## Order Cutoff Endpoint

The Crumbvale API enforces a daily order cutoff for wholesale bakery orders: requests received after the configured cutoff time are queued for the next production day and flagged in the response payload. The cutoff value itself is managed centrally by the Proofline policy service and cannot be overridden per request, which limits tampering surface. For review purposes, note that all reads of the cutoff policy are authenticated and audited. The sandbox environment authenticates using the service key provided below.

API key for yahig-tadup: kto7_ubizbYm